In a world where tradition meets innovation, a new generation of performers: creators, dreamers, and storytellers, is quietly reweaving the fabric of classical music. Their time to be heard is now. Rosie Murphy, Paidir chiúin a rá (2024) (Ireland), Maximilian Treller, suite for harp nr1 (Germany), Nadja Floder, Longing for Eternity, opus 22 (2022) (Austria), Charisma Chow (Canada), Eileen C.K. Shafer, Fly Trap & MicroBiome (USA), Almos Tallos, Sonate for harp, opus 6 (Hungary) (his participation is still pending)
